Qualifications:

  • Master’s degree in Speech-Language Pathology or Communication Sciences & Disorders
  • Active SLP license in Colorado (or willingness to obtain)
  • Certificate of Clinical Competence (CCC-SLP)
  • Experience in pediatric, healthcare, and school settings
  • Strong communication, organizational, and collaboration skills

Responsibilities:

  • Conduct screenings, assessments, and therapy for students with speech and language needs
  • Develop and implement individualized education and therapy plans
  • Collaborate with educators, parents, and interdisciplinary teams for optimal student outcomes
  • Maintain accurate and timely documentation in compliance with school and professional standards
  • Participate in IEP meetings and contribute to student progress reporting
